Peggy Joan (Smith) Johnson passed away at her home in Mesa, Arizona on May 27, 2021.

Peggy was born in Pepin, Wisconsin to Merville Henry Smith and Dorothy Mae (Seyffer) Smith on May 29th, 1947. She grew up on the family farm in rural Durand, along with her siblings, Bill, Herb, John, Patty and Dennis.

From early on in her life, Peggy had a love of horses and dogs. That continued her whole life as she always had a dog or two, and a horse and she loved trail riding with friends.

Peggy married John Hubbard in 1965. To this union, two daughters were born, Melissa Anne and Barbara Jo. Peggy and John later divorced.

In 1971, Peggy and John moved to Omaha, Nebraska where they lived on and managed a small thoroughbred farm. They were fortunate to be in the “Winner’s Circle” at Ak-Sar-Ben Horse Racing Track with a colt they had helped raise, named Key Fella, for his first win.

In 1978, they returned to Wisconsin to the rural Eau Galle area. At that time, Peggy acquired her insurance licenses and became an agent for the family business, M. H. Smith Insurance Agency in Durand. The business was owned by her father, Merville, and later by her brother, Herb. Although she wrote insurance for all lines, farms were her specialty. She continued to sell insurance for over 30 years, retiring in 2009.

Peggy met Jerry Johnson in Baldwin while out with some friends. They were married on September 30th, 2000. Peggy moved to rural Wilson with Jerry on his buffalo farm and later helped him run Jerry’s Bar after she retired from the insurance business. Peggy and Jerry loved Las Vegas and playing poker, and they traveled there as often as possible. When Jerry retired and the bar closed, they purchased a winter home in Mesa, Arizona. After Jerry’s passing in 2017, Peggy began to spend more and more time there. She had family and many good friends in Mesa.

Peggy is preceded in death by her parents, her husband Jerry, brothers John and Dennis, sisters-in-law Mary Smith and Karen Johnson, and ex-husband, John.

She is survived by her daughters, Melissa (Chuck) Roatch and Barbara (Joel) Olson, stepson Rodney Johnson, grandchildren, Laura, Lindsey, Lucas, Logan, Luke and Samantha, great-grandchildren Madalyn, Kendalyn and Sophie Jo. She is further survived by her brothers, Bill and Herb, and sister Patty (Jon) Pfeilsticker, and nieces and nephews.
